Fog Catcher is our flagship blend and is made from our best Bordeaux grapes each year. Heart Hill Vineyard’s rocky hillsides and temperate weather produce dense, rich and complex wines. It’s planted with a diverse blend of Cabernet Sauvignon clones along with smaller amounts of Malbec, Merlot and Petit Verdot that make great blending partners for this wine. We also farm Carménère at Bootjack Ranch where the warmer climate allows this notoriously tough to ripen varietal to flourish.
IN THE VINEYARD:
The 2016 vintage was defined by a drought lifting rainy winter, warm spring and even temperatures throughout the growing season. In other words: as close to perfect a vintage in Paso Robles as you can get. The result was a wonderfully balanced vintage where optimal flavor development and great natural acidity gave us many high quality barrels of wine to select from.
IN THE WINERY:
Fog Catcher is equal parts high quality grapes and dynamic winemaking techniques. This combination creates a dark, rich wine with luxurious texture, precise tannins and an underlying freshness. The foundation of the 2016 Fog Catcher is a co-ferment of our best block of Cabernet Sauvignon with a small amount of Petit Verdot. After harvest, a selection of other noteworthy Bordeaux barrels were marked and tucked away into the cellar to mature. Nearly a year later, our Winemaker revisited each barrel to make his final decision on which barrels qualified for this wine. The composed blend then returned oak barrels for additional aging. The 2016 vintage of Fog Catcher is a harmonious blend of intriguing spice, dark fruits and expansive tannins that linger on your palate for minutes after drinking. This wine is rewarding to drink in its youth, and the high potential it has for aging 10+ years is apparent.
- BLEND:
45% Cabernet Sauvignon
26% Malbec
14% Petit Verdot
15% Carménère
VINEYARD:
83% Heart Hill Vineyard
17% Bootjack Ranch
AGED: 29 months, 90% New French Oak
pH: 3.6
TA: 6.7 g/L
ALCOHOL: 14.6%
